Will Sexual Assault Awareness Month get lost amid COVID-19?

Many programs are hosting virtual events, such as Take Back the Night events. Many are also pushing out information via social media. When creating and hosting online events, consider accessibility for people with disabilities and Deaf people. The Vera Institute of Justice has created tip sheet for hosting virtual events: https://www.endabusepwd.org/publications/accessibility-tip-sheet-for-virtual-meetings-and-events/. Vera has also created a tip sheet for using accessible social media: https://www.endabusepwd.org/resource/tips-for-using-accessible-social-media/.
